A fire breaks out in one of Yunnan Energy New Material’s manufacturing facilities, causing significant damage and disrupting production. There are no injuries, but the incident has attracted media attention and raised concerns among investors and the local community. Which of the following communication strategies is MOST critical for Yunnan Energy New Material to implement in the immediate aftermath of the fire?
Correct
Effective communication during a crisis is paramount for maintaining stakeholder trust and minimizing reputational damage. This involves providing timely, accurate, and transparent information to all relevant parties, including employees, customers, investors, and the media. It’s crucial to designate a spokesperson who is well-trained in crisis communication and can effectively address concerns and answer questions. The communication strategy should be proactive, rather than reactive, anticipating potential questions and addressing them before they arise. It’s also important to tailor the communication to the specific needs of each stakeholder group, using appropriate channels and language. Ignoring the crisis or providing misleading information can erode trust and damage the company’s reputation, potentially leading to long-term consequences.

Yunnan Energy New Material relies heavily on a specific supplier for lithium carbonate, a critical raw material. Unexpectedly, this supplier faces a complete production halt due to stringent new environmental regulations imposed by the Yunnan provincial government. Which of the following actions BEST exemplifies adaptability and strategic foresight in this crisis, aligning with Yunnan Energy New Material’s values of sustainable practices and customer commitment?
Correct
In a rapidly evolving sector like new energy materials, adaptability is paramount. Consider a scenario where a key supplier of a crucial raw material, lithium carbonate, faces unexpected production halts due to environmental compliance issues mandated by new provincial regulations in Yunnan. This directly impacts Yunnan Energy New Material’s production schedule and cost projections for its lithium-ion battery precursors. A proactive and adaptable response involves several key actions: immediately assessing the impact on existing production schedules and customer commitments; exploring alternative sourcing options, including both domestic and international suppliers, while carefully evaluating their compliance with environmental and labor standards; re-evaluating existing inventory levels and optimizing production plans to mitigate potential shortages; communicating transparently with customers about potential delays and working collaboratively to find solutions; and actively engaging with the procurement and R&D teams to investigate potential alternative materials that could reduce reliance on the affected supplier in the long term. Furthermore, this situation necessitates a review of the company’s risk management strategies and supplier diversification plans to prevent similar disruptions in the future. The ideal response balances short-term mitigation with long-term resilience, demonstrating adaptability, strategic thinking, and proactive communication. The company’s commitment to ethical sourcing and environmental responsibility should remain a guiding principle throughout the response.
